Old English Seax, a knife, used of the single-edged iron cleavers common in European Saxon and Anglo-Saxon graves Continental versions have a curving back; English types (late 6th-century and later) are straight-backed with an angle near the point

Simple API for XML" An event-driven interface in which the parser invokes one of several methods supplied by the caller when a "parsing event" occurs "Events" include recognizing an XML tag, finding an error, encountering a reference to an external entity, or processing a DTD specification

Adolphe Sax
orig. Antoine-Joseph Sax born Nov. 6, 1814, Dinant, Belg. died Feb. 7, 1894, Paris, France Belgian instrument maker. Son of an accomplished instrument maker, he worked for his father until 1842, making improvements on the clarinet and bass clarinet. He then set up shop in Paris, supported by musicians such as Hector Berlioz and Fromental Halévy (1799-1862) but opposed by French instrument makers; he invented several new families of instruments, including the saxhorns, the saxtrombas, and most successfully, the saxophones. A fine woodwind player, he taught saxophone at the Paris Conservatoire (1857-71)
